People don't just put sheets on the beds like in the past. With the development of technology, new generation methods can be used to extend the life of the mattress. Mattress protectors, called protective layers, are among these methods. Mattress protector can basically be interpreted as a kind of protective apparatus laid on the bed without sheets for protection. The mattress covers also prevent the mattress from getting dirty over time. These special materials come in different types according to their structure.
Among the types of alzes, especially cotton and liquid-proof mattress protectors come to the fore. Especially liquid-proof mattress covers provide a very high level of protection as they are two-layer. The top layer is made of cotton. The bottom layer is made of liquid impermeable polyester. It has the function of trapping liquids in the top layer. In addition to single and double beds, it can also be used directly on baby beds.
The part of the mattress that is in contact with the bed is at the bottom and it has a liquid-proof feature. This section is covered with linoleum material. In addition, the airtight nature of the part in question ensures that it does not come into contact with the body. The part in direct contact with the body is located directly in the fabric tissue. In this sense, the linoleum section in the mattress; no matter how much liquid is spilled, it will prevent this liquid from reaching the mattress. It is a safe protection against basic sleep problems such as body fluid leaks and incontinence.

PVC coated fabrics, polyester fabrics, cottons or elastic type bands are used as materials in the structure of the mattress protector, which have an important role for a healthy sleep life as well as extending the life of the mattress. The quality of such protectors is extremely important for people who value their mattresses.
There are rubberized slots in each corner of the mattress protector that help them to hold onto the mattress more comfortably. This prevents slipping and bunching.
